Outraged Mike Norvell Appeals After Florida State Snubbed From College Football Playoffs

Florida State Denied CFP Spot

The Florida State Seminoles were left in shock and sorrow after they were denied a spot for the College Football Playoffs when the final rankings were released. Head Coach Mike Norvell released a statement to express his frustration and justified anger at the news.

In his statement, Norvell labelled it “a sad day for Seminole Nation” and noted how they were, in his view, “extremely deserving to be in the field of four.” He went on to further state how he “could not be any more disgusted, outraged or infuriated” with the decision by the College Football Playoff committee.
